Squad continuity under Mikel Arteta and defensive organization give them an edge in a race that remains wide open early on. Manchester City, now led by Enzo Maresca after Pep Guardiola’s departure, sit as the primary challengers following a second-place finish last term, while Chelsea, Liverpool, and Manchester United feature new managerial setups and roster adjustments that could shift momentum. The tight clustering of probabilities around the top contenders underscores the league’s depth, with multiple clubs possessing the resources and recent form to mount sustained title challenges over a long season.

"EPL: 2027 Champion" is a prediction market on Polymarket with 20 possible outcomes where traders buy and sell shares based on what they believe will happen. The current leading outcome is "Arsenal" at 51%, followed by "Manchester City" at 23%. Prices reflect real-time crowd-sourced probabilities. For example, a share priced at 51¢ implies that the market collectively assigns a 51% chance to that outcome. These odds shift continuously as traders react to new developments and information. Shares in the correct outcome are redeemable for $1 each upon market resolution.
